Say, "Travel through the land; then observe how was the end of the deniers." 11 Say, “To Whom does all whatever is in the heavens and the earth, belong?” Proclaim, “To Allah”; He has made mercy obligatory upon His grace; undoubtedly, He will surely gather you all together on the Day of Resurrection in which there is no doubt; those who put their souls to ruin, do not accept faith. 12 ۞ Unto Him belongeth whatsoever resteth in the night and the day. He is the Hearer, the Knower. 13 (Muhammad), ask them, "Should I take a guardian other than God, the Originator of the heavens and the earth, who feeds everyone and who needs no food Himself?" Say, "I have been commanded to be the first Muslim (submitted to the will of God). Thus, people, do not be pagans." 14 Say, “If I disobey my Lord, I then fear the punishment of the Great Day (of Resurrection).” 15 From whomsoever it is averted on that Day, He will have mercy on him; that is a clear triumph. 16 If Allah visits you with affliction, none can remove it except He; and if He touches you with good, indeed, He has power over all things. 17 He is the Omnipotent over His slaves, and He is the Wise, the Knower. 18 Ask them: 'Whose testimony is the greatest?' Say: 'Allah is the witness between me and you; and this Qur'an was revealed to me that I should warn you thereby and also whomsoever it may reach.' Do you indeed testify that there are other gods with Allah? Say: 'I shall never testify such a thing.' Say: 'He is the One God and I am altogether averse to all that you associate with Him in His divinity.' 19 Those unto whom We gave the Scripture recognise (this revelation) as they recognise their sons. Those who ruin their own souls will not believe. 20
